In Western Sydney's growing area, it's crucial to understand the distinction between a regular electrician and a qualified ASP Level 2 Electrician in Penrith, as this difference substantially affects residential or commercial property security and compliance with the law. Normal residential electricians are competent in managing indoor electrical work, such as wiring, outlets, and lighting, however they are not lawfully permitted to work on the electrical distribution network owned by companies like Endeavour Energy. An ASP Level 2 Electrician in Penrith, on the other hand, has actually finished comprehensive specialized training, earning them accreditation to carry out complex and high-risk jobs, including linking and disconnecting residential or commercial properties from the main electrical more info grid. This competence is vital for jobs including overhead power lines, underground cable televisions, and the setup of advanced metering systems. For citizens and businesses in the area, working with an ASP Level 2 Electrician in Penrith is not simply a matter of individual choice, but a legal requirement when dealing with the connection in between public and personal electrical systems, ensuring that high-voltage connections are handled with accuracy to prevent mishaps, power outages, or other security risks.
Among the most important situations needing the intervention of an ASP Level 2 Electrician Penrith occurs when a property is issued a main flaw notification by the local energy distributor. These notifications are usually delivered after an inspector recognizes a harmful condition on the consumer's side of the connection, such as a decaying personal power pole, torn service cable televisions, or an out-of-date point of attachment that no longer satisfies modern safety codes. Because these concerns involve the live "service" side of the electrical system, just an ASP Level 2 Electrician Penrith is permitted to break the seals, detach the power safely, and perform the necessary repair work to bring the system back into compliance. As of 2026, the complexity of these repair work has actually increased with the necessary combination of digital compliance reporting through the eCert system in New South Wales. By working with a qualified ASP Level 2 Electrician Penrith, homeowner ensure that their remedial work is formally recorded with the authorities, which is a crucial requirement for preserving valid building insurance coverage and ensuring the long-term structural stability of the electrical connection.
The growing emphasis on achieving energy self-sufficiency in a contemporary context has heightened the requirement for an ASP Level 2 Electrician in Penrith. This is specifically apparent as Australian homes look for to integrate big solar arrays and battery storage systems. In many older houses with a single-phase electrical supply, there is typically anacy to support the power requirements of modern-day state-of-the-art homes equipped with electrical vehicle fast-chargers and centralized cooling. An ASP Level 2 Electrician in Penrith plays a vital function in upgrading properties to a three-phase power supply, which necessitates the installation of more robust consumer mains and advanced metering units to handle the increased electrical load. To effectively finish this job, a deep understanding of the network's capacity is required, along with the ability to work on live properties without causing interruptions to surrounding homes. Additionally, an ASP Level 2 Electrician in Penrith is proficient in the setup of clever meters, allowing precise billing and the monitoring of real-time energy usage and production. The effective development of businesses and new real estate locations in the region greatly depends on the technical abilities of an ASP Level 2 Electrician based in Penrith during the initial building and construction stages. Prior to any building and construction work beginning, the ASP Level 2 Electrician is often entrusted with setting up short-term power for contractors, making sure a safe electrical power supply for heavy devices and building and construction website facilities. In contemporary suburbs where overhead power lines are being replaced by underground systems, the ASP Level 2 Electrician undertakes complex jobs such as digging trenches, setting up conduits, and linking structures to the underground network through cable television jointing. Their proficiency is vital in appropriately securing these underground service lines against moisture and physical harm, hence avoiding costly failures that would be challenging to fix once landscaping and driveways are in place.
